Italian Wines - Discover The Secrets

How's the best way to enjoy Italian wines? Easy. The absolutely, positively the only and best way to enjoy wine is "Open the bottle, pour some wine in a glass and enjoy!"Unlike wines from some other parts of Europe, who have to make believe that they are so proper by demanding elaborate pouring and tasting rituals, these wines are just like Italian food. Unpretentious and meant to be enjoyed!

Just because Italian wines are easy to drink doesn't mean that they hold second class citizenship in the world of fine vineyards. Once mocked by serious wine connoisseurs because it only came in a straw-covered bottle, today's Chianti region produces wines that can proudly hold themselves up next to the great wines of Europe.

The vineyards and wineries of Italy have made great strides and advances in quality over the last twenty years. Italian vineyards have reduced or even eliminated the various harsh fertilizers and chemicals that they once used. Many grapes are grown organically and that fresh, natural taste is apparent from the first sip of
thisgreat wine to the last.

Perhaps the thing that makes this wine so enjoyable is that these wines have a unique and easily identifiable Italian flavor that is unmatched by wines from any other region on earth.

Whether it's a Chianti, Barolo, Barbaresco, Dolcetto or a Rifosco, there is no doubt that you are drinking great wines of Italy as soon as the flavors burst upon your palette!

Italian wines are like Italian foods. They are rich, robust, and are meant to be enjoyed anywhere, anytime. Experts agree that Italy now has more types of vines growing than any other wine-producing country. It's easy to see why Italy produces such a wide range of wonderfully distinctive wines.
